Promotional and Advertising Strategies: A Comparative Analysis of Toyota Motors and General Motors - Page 4 preview imagePromotional and Advertising Strategies3AbstractThe production and management systems in many industries get revolutionized globallydue to changing technologies. The automobile industry is not left behind and is currently facingnew opportunities and threats. Increase in safety requirements, globalization, digitalization andindividualization are a few factors that are spearheading the change in the industry. Survival ofcompanies has been made uncertain, and only those that consumers find to add value areguaranteed the existence. This paper will analyze two leading automobile industries, ToyotaMotors and General Motors, and the marketing techniques and strategies that have enabled theirsurvival in the recent past. The study will reveal that environmental interpretation and aspirationto the usage of new technology are important factors for the generation of profit and retention ofthe market share in the automobile industry.
